Types of Tree Stands
A lock-on tree stand has a simple setting that you only need to attach the platform to the tree securely. You can adjust the straps and make sure that it’s stable enough to hold your weight safely. This type of stand is ideal for most kinds of trees in the forest, even ones with crooked trunks or lots of branches. With this tree stand, you will have plenty of spots and options for where to set up.
It is simple to get into and out of this kind of tree stand. And best of all, it’s quiet, so you won’t spook your target. You can secure it tightly enough to leave it in place, covered, during the off-season, and it’ll be ready when hunting season rolls back around. Just keep in mind, you’ll need separate climbing sticks or steps to get it attached to the tree.
Even though climbing tree stands offer the platform and the seat separately, which might make you feel awkward at first, climbing tree stands offer one big advantage, which is portability. This tree stand is easy to take down as they are easy to set up, making it perfect for hunters with high mobility. To climb it up, you just need to secure your feet to the platform, unlock the section, and lift it up.
The stand’s sharp "teeth” bite into the tree, keeping it steady and secure. Once you’ve climbed to your ideal height, strap it in with a safety harness, and you’re set. Because it’s easy to remove after each hunt, you can keep your favorite hunting spot under wraps with no risk of other hunters claiming your spot.
Ladder stands are usually the priciest option, but for good reason. The platform and seat are fixed in place, and a multi-piece ladder makes climbing up straightforward. The whole setup is secured with straps or belts. It’s a little tight since there are no extra footholds, but that’s why the ladder is there. Once you’re up top, it’s stable, comfortable, and user-friendly.
With a ladder, you’ll have more weight to carry, so setting it up usually requires another person. But ladder stands are comfortable and especially good for hunters who have trouble climbing. The downside is that the elevated ladder makes the stand more visible to game. The plus side is that many ladder stands come with features you won’t find elsewhere, like big platforms and cushioned seats.
The name might sound a bit off-topic, but tripod and tower stands serve the same purpose as tree stands, without needing a tree. These stands have a platform supported by three legs, just like a camera tripod. One major advantage is a full 360-degree view, which you don’t get with traditional tree stands. Setting this stand is quite easy. First, you need to stabilize the legs on the ground and secure the platform on top. You might need some helpers to assemble it, but once it’s in place, it can be for a long run.
Once you set it up and leave it for a while, animals can get used to it and treat it as a part of the environment, instead of being scared of it. If you hunt with a friend, this platform can hold 2 people, and you can even add extras such as a hunting blind to stay hidden while you wait for your game.
Hunting blinds, like treestands, work effectively only if they provide you with an ethical shooting opportunity and keep you hidden.
Types of Hunting Blinds
Fabric hunting blind is the simplest and most common hunting blind. This hunting blind offers the perfect balance of ease and stealth by allowing hunters to blend in with the environment without compromising visibility, which will give you a great field of vision.
If you’re looking for a blind that you can use and put up during deer season and turkey season, this one is more than capable of handling the job. Just remember to stake it down if you want it to remain in place during strong winds.
- 360 Degree Panoramic Hunting Blind
This hunting blind provides 360 degrees of shooting, making it ideal for standing bow shots with no blind spot. You can see every angle if your surrounding and track game effortlessly, all while staying concealed in smart camouflage. With this, even the most alert deer or ducks won’t detect you until it’s too late.
This is the combination of a hunting blind and a tree stand. This hunting blind comes with its elevated tower that will put you up high, cozy, and completely concealed. It’s like your personal hideout in the wild. From the top of this tower hunting blind, you can see your game from afar and plan strategically. Even the wariest deer won’t know your hiding place.
With this tower hunting blind, you can stay warm, hidden, and free from glare that could make the prey alert. It doesn’t matter the game, be it a deer in the forest, ducks by the lake, or just waiting for the perfect shot, this elevated blind offers comfort, hiding place, and an unbeatable view from above.
